Understanding Grief Counseling 


Grief counseling is a form of therapy aimed at helping individuals cope with the emotional, psychological, and social aspects of losing a loved one. It provides a safe and supportive environment where people can express their feelings, work through their grief, and begin to adjust to life without their loved one. The process often involves exploring the various stages of grief, which include denial, anger, bargaining, depression, and acceptance. While not everyone experiences these stages in a linear fashion, understanding them can help individuals make sense of their emotions.

Benefits of Grief Counseling 


The benefits of grief counseling are manifold. For many, it provides validation and understanding of their feelings, helping them realize they are not alone in their grief. Counseling can help individuals: 


  • Express Emotions: Many people find it challenging to articulate their feelings after a loss. Grief counseling provides a safe space to express emotions without judgment. 
  • Navigate Changes: Losing a loved one often brings about significant changes in one's life. Counseling can assist in adjusting to new roles and routines. 
  • Develop Coping Strategies: Counselors can help individuals develop healthy coping mechanisms to manage their grief, reducing the risk of complicated grief or depression. 
  • Find Meaning: Grief counseling can aid in finding meaning in the loss and help individuals integrate the memory of their loved one into their lives in a positive way. 
  • Support Networks: Support groups facilitated by funeral homes can connect individuals with others who are experiencing similar losses, fostering a sense of community and shared understanding. 


The Importance of Community Support 


Funeral homes also play an essential role in fostering community support. They often host memorial services, remembrance events, and educational seminars that bring people together. These events provide opportunities for communal grieving, allowing individuals to share their experiences and find solace in the presence of others who understand their pain. 


In addition to formal counseling services, the staff at funeral homes can offer empathetic listening and guidance. They often have a wealth of resources, including books, online forums, and connections to local support groups, which can be invaluable to those in mourning. By partnering with community organizations, funeral homes can extend their reach and offer more comprehensive support to the bereaved.
